Web1 de jan. de 2024 · The three long tracts are the (1) corticospinal, (2) dorsal columns, and (3) spinothalamic. The corticospinal tract is a descending or motor pathway, and the dorsal columns and spinothalamic tracts are sensory pathways or ascending pathways. WebSigns and symptoms of DIPG result from its involvement of cranial nerves/nuclei, corticospinal tracts, and cerebellum. The classic triad of symptoms includes cranial neuropathies, long tract signs and ataxia. The cranial nerves most commonly involved at presentation are the abducens (VI) and facial (VII) nerves.
